Alcatel-Lucent Demonstrates Improved Mobile Broadcasting Solution

[Satellite Today 08-29-08] Alcatel-Lucent is demonstrating a new and improved version of its mobile broadcasting solution at the IFA (Internationale Funkausstellung) trade show starting today in Berlin. For the first time in Europe, the company is demonstrating MPE-iFEC (Multi-Protocol Encapsulation - inter-burst Forward Error Correction), a powerful error-correction coding that improves the quality of broadcast mobile TV reception in hybrid satellite and terrestrial networks. This feature is embedded in the DVB-SH mobile broadcast standard (Digital Video Broadcast – Satellite services to Handhelds).
    In a satellite DVB-SH reception context, MPE-iFEC is an extension of the traditional MPE-FEC (Multi-Protocol Encapsulation Forward Error Correction) error correction system used in terrestrial systems. The MPE-FEC extension through inter-burst FEC compensates long shadowing by providing additional time diversity. MPE-iFEC is an attractive alternative to the long physical interleaver standard option for those small receivers, which cannot afford a large and fast de-interleaving memory.
